Old Bay Seafood Boil Recipe
A classic seafood boil with Old Bay seasoning, perfect for gatherings.

Main Ingredients
- 1 package Old Bay Seasoning
- 4 quarts Water
- 2 pounds Red Potatoes halved
- 1 pound Andouille Sausage sliced
- 4 ears Corn halved
- 2 pounds Shrimp deveined
- 2 pounds Clams scrubbed
Fill a large pot with water and add Old Bay seasoning. Bring to a boil.
Add potatoes and cook for 10 minutes.
Add sausage and corn, cook for another 10 minutes.
Add shrimp and clams, cook until shrimp are pink and clams open, about 5-7 minutes.
Drain and serve hot.
